logo

Output 82d0a90ea7d563af52eed959d6812476c1fa68f828ba1e5e434e9c34a78cf558:2

value
46314694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75128f35dbca0952c784fc644ca6d446fd196759 OP_EQUAL
address
3CN3DX3Csiry7wK4RDndVRU4CR78AMcMNa
transaction
82d0a90ea7d563af52eed959d6812476c1fa68f828ba1e5e434e9c34a78cf558